The role you’ll contribute:

Under general supervision performs General Sonographic procedures in accordance with department protocols. Actively participates in outstanding customer service and accepts responsibility in maintaining relationships that are equally respectful to all. Adheres to the AdventHealth Corporate Compliance Plan and to all rules and regulations of all applicable local, state, and federal agencies and accrediting bodies

 

The value you’ll bring to the team:

·       Performs a full range of diagnostic ultrasound procedures and operates all ultrasound equipment in assigned department.  Is willing and able to rotate between multiple campuses/US departments as needed. Demonstrates the knowledge and skills for age-specific factors necessary to perform safe and effective procedures on patients of all ages (neonate/infant, pediatric, adolescent, adult, and geriatrics). 

·       Assists with data collection for KPI's while understanding the department performance trends and established standards.  Contributes toward process improvement by serving on PI teams as assigned.  Participates in department patient satisfaction initiatives.  Utilizes patient service recovery resources when appropriate.  [Performance Improvement]

·       Attends department meetings consistently and promotes positive dialogue with respect to department objectives.  Listens and is responsible to understand all agenda items. Attends all other meetings as required. [Department Meeting Attendance] 

·       Performs other duties as assigned or directed to ensure the smooth operation of the department.

·       P2DS must also agree to the conditions of the Florida Hospital (FH) Per Diem Option Agreement (contract).

 
Qualifications
What Will You Need:        

E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E REQUIRED:

  • Graduate of Ultrasound Program
 

LICENSURE, CERTIFICATION OR REGISTRATION REQUIRED:

  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certification

   A minimum of the following two American Registry for Diagnostic Medical Sonography (ARDMS) specialty examinations:

    1. Registered Diagnostic Medical Sonographer (RDMS) - Abdomen (AB) 
    2. Registered Diagnostic Medical Sonographer (RDMS) - Obstetrics & Gynecology (OB/GYN) 
    3. Registered Diagnostic Medical Sonographer (RDMS) - Breast (BR) 
    4. Registered Diagnostic Medical Sonographer (RDMS) - Registered Vascular Technologist (RVT)
